Item Modelo de Simulação Computacional para Balanceamento de Linhas de Produção das Empresas Cerâmicas de São Miguel do Guamá: Um Estudo de Caso(Instituto de Tecnologia, 2013) SILVA, Denilson Costa da; ICHIHARA, Jorge de AraújoThis work presents a computer simulation model to address the production line balancing problem in a red ceramic factory in São Miguel do Guamá. The study includes a literature review on discrete event systems, balancing methods, and modeling and simulation concepts. The methodology follows the method proposed by Chwif (1999), covering design, implementation, and analysis. The developed model describes the current state of the process, identifies bottlenecks, and proposes improvements through scenarios, with the third scenario showing the best results. These companies produce effluents coming from units of paint by blasting and spraying. This waste requires special treatment for their separation, storage and disposal. This paper studies an alternative way to use this waste in the red ceramic industry, evaluating parameters that influence important properties of artifacts made of red clay as density, porosity and bending strength, measured for mixtures of 2%, 5% and 10% by weight of waste, for the clay used, the results show that there is influence of this material in solid state reactions and can improve the properties cited.
